As competition increases, educational institutions are under extreme pressure to increase the quality of teaching and learning. Advances in mobile technologies, together with better and more powerful personal digital devices and a growing mobile ecosystem are key enablers of the next big wave in education: mobile learning (m-learning). Students, who are digital natives, and educators are already using mobile technologies in diverse contexts, but turning m-learning into a widespread practice requires planning and knowledge about its pros and cons, demonstrating its usefulness and adequacy to all skeptical audiences, and designing learning in a different way, with new knowledge and skills. This study describes the main characteristics of m-learning, and outlines the potential of mobile technologies for education. Similarly, the research presents criteria for successful integration of mobile technologies in learning environments. The study also offers an overview of the main barriers to m-learning adoption, presenting the main challenges and trends ?from both technological and educational perspectives? in digital mobile contexts. In sum, the research analyzes the current state of m-learning and offers a critical assessment of its potential for bridging formal and informal learning, inside and outside educational institutions, including home environments. | |
